How to Incorporate Flowers into Your Travels

If you’re wondering how to bring flowers into your family trips, here are some simple ideas:

  • Explore Local Flora: During hikes or park visits, encourage your kids to gather a few local flowers. It’s a great way to learn about the region’s nature.
  • Decorate Your Space: If you’re staying in a rental or hotel, consider ordering a small bouquet to brighten up the room. It adds a personal touch and makes the space feel more like home.
  • Make Floral Keepsakes: Dry the flowers you collect during your trip and use them to create handmade postcards or frame them as a souvenir.

Practical Tips for Traveling with Flowers

To make flowers a seamless part of your trip, a little planning goes a long way. Here are some tips to keep in mind:

  • Opt for Durable Flowers: If you’re bringing flowers along, choose varieties that stay fresh longer, like daisies or marigolds.
  • Pack Mini Vases: For picnics or car trips, bring small, lightweight vases. They’re easy to carry and perfect for displaying flowers on the go.
  • Capture Floral Moments: Use flowers as props for family photos. Place a bouquet on the table during meals or photograph your kids holding flowers in scenic locations.

Flowers as a Source of Creativity

Flowers aren’t just for decoration—they’re also a wonderful way to spark creativity, especially for kids. During your travels, try these fun activities:

  • Sketch the flowers you find in parks or gardens.
  • Create a mini herbarium from collected plants to remember your trip.
  • Make flower crowns together—a playful activity that kids, especially girls, will love.
